Improved three-phase power flow method for calculation of power losses in unbalanced radial distribution network

Recently, the need for improving the efficiency of distribution network in terms of power losses is being emphasised. A large share of total power losses refers to low-voltage networks which are usually unbalanced. For the power flow analysis, it is necessary to use three-phase modelling. This study presents modelling of distribution network elements and their implementation in backward/forward sweep (BFS) power flow method. An improvement of the BFS method is developed by using the breadth-first search method for network renumbering and creation of modified incidence matrix. The improved method minimises the read elements of each iteration and results in a significant reduction in total calculation time without accuracy loss. This improvement makes this method more suitable for using in real-time calculations. The proposed method is used for calculation of power losses in unbalanced and symmetrical network which are compared. The purpose of this test is to show the advantage of a three-phase power flow analysis compared with a symmetrical model.
